Rare footage of family of four snow leopards in NW China

Infrared cameras captured rare footage of a mother snow leopard with her three cubs in the nature reserve from last winter to this spring at Xitianshan National Nature Reserve in the Xinjiang Uygur Autonomous Region, northwestern China. Snow leopards are under first-class protection in the country.